Your book seems to be listed as an "official" score. According to the MuseScore.com website:
Quote:
Official Scores: Available exclusively to MuseScore Pro+ subscribers, these licensed arrangements include everything from pop hits to movie soundtracks to contemporary classical. All Official Scores are uploaded by leading publishers, matching the premium quality of any printed sheet music collection. There are over 44,000 Official Scores to discover.
https://help.musescore.com/en/articles/8535861-musescore-com
From this, it sounds like something which you need to take up with your publisher.
